On Thu, Nov 14, 2013 at 06:31:28AM -0800, saxmad wrote: Having recently updated to v4.0.7 from v3.6.7, my users have noticed a small but fundamental change in the way the bulk updater screen works for them. When they do more than one bulk update at once, ie without coming out of the bulk update screen, then the settings have been remembered from the previous update. If they don't notice this, or forget, they then apply the wrong update settings to the tickets. The old version did not exhibit this, but cleared all the settings as though coming in fresh each time. This has been fixed multiple times throughout 3.8 and 4.0 and 4.2, and the behavior you described is the desired RT behavior and I find it unlikely that it will revert back to what you were seeing in 3.6. -kevin pgp5fPSgGCfRL.pgp Description: PGP signature
